AI-Driven Innovations in Chatbot Development

The integration of artificial intelligence has drastically changed the way chatbots function in social media. AI technologies such as natural language processing enable chatbots to understand and respond to human language more effectively. This capability allows users to engage in more fluid conversations, making interactions feel less robotic and more genuine. Additionally, advancements in sentiment analysis enable chatbots to detect users’ emotions and adjust their responses accordingly. By doing so, they can provide personalized support that meets the emotional needs of the customer. For instance, if a user expresses frustration, an AI-driven chatbot can empathize and offer solutions accordingly. Such innovations are instrumental in elevating customer satisfaction because they foster a more human-like interaction. Furthermore, the deployment of voice-activated chatbots is becoming increasingly prominent, allowing users to interact through voice commands. This shift caters to the growing demand for hands-free technology, making chatbots accessible on a broader scale. Moving forward, businesses will need to invest in AI-enhanced chatbots to remain competitive and meet the expectations of today’s consumers seeking instant and emotional connectivity.

The continual evolution of social media chatbots brings unique challenges, particularly concerning data privacy and ethical considerations. As chatbots become more intertwined with aspects of personal data, organizations must implement strong privacy measures to protect user information. Customers are becoming more aware of privacy issues, and they expect brands to handle their data responsibly. This scrutiny necessitates transparency in chatbot communications and a clear understanding of how user data is collected, stored, and utilized. Furthermore, maintaining compliance with regulations such as GDPR is essential to avoid legal repercussions. Therefore, organizations must ensure their chatbot capabilities prioritize ethical considerations while still providing personalized experiences. This approach not only builds trust with consumers but also reinforces the brand’s commitment to safeguarding user data. Additionally, as social media platforms develop new policies regarding bots, organizations must remain agile in adapting their strategies. Establishing robust ethical guidelines and accountability standards will be crucial as chatbot adoption continues to grow. Balancing innovation with responsibility will determine how effectively chatbots interact with users while adhering to ethical practices as their influence spreads.

Future Opportunities in the Chatbot Space

The future of social media chatbots is filled with exciting opportunities that can reshape user interactions. With the growing emphasis on artificial intelligence, these automated systems are expected to become more intuitive, enabling them to predict user needs proactively. Imagine a chatbot that anticipates your questions based on your previous interactions or current trends. This level of proactivity not only enhances user experience but also fosters a stronger connection between customers and brands. Companies should also explore utilizing chatbots for community management, where they can facilitate discussions and encourage user-generated content. By building dynamic communities, brands can enhance engagement while streamlining their outreach efforts. Another promising area is the integration of augmented reality (AR) with chatbots, enabling brands to offer immersive experiences. For example, cosmetics brands could allow users to virtually try on products through chatbot interactions. Such innovations represent a significant leap in how businesses can utilize chatbots for marketing, engagement, and customer experience enhancement. Staying informed about these emerging trends will position brands strategically to leverage social media chatbots effectively and capitalize on their full potential in the coming years.
